Question:

Which planet's rotation is different from the earth’s rotation?

Show Hint

Venus's rotation is different from Earth’s because it rotates in the opposite direction (retrograde), while most planets, including Earth, rotate in a prograde direction.

Let’s break down the solution step by step: Step 1:
Mercury's rotation is similar to Earth's in that it rotates on its axis in a prograde direction (in the same direction as its orbit). Thus, Mercury is not the correct answer.

Step 2:
Venus is unique in that it rotates in the opposite direction (retrograde) to its orbit.
It has a very slow rotation, taking about 243 Earth days to complete one rotation, while its orbit around the Sun takes only about 225 Earth days.
Thus, Venus has a different rotational pattern compared to Earth.

Step 3:
Mars rotates similarly to Earth, with a 24.6-hour day, so it is not the correct answer.

Step 4:
Jupiter's rotation is also similar to Earth's, with a day length of about 10 hours, so it is not the correct answer.

Step 5:
Conclusion:
The correct answer is (2) Venus, because Venus has a retrograde rotation, unlike Earth's prograde rotation.
